Registering property: Cost in Kosovo
Kosovo: Registering property: Cost was 0.3% in 2019. ▼ Falling
Registering property: Cost in Kosovo, 2009–2019
Source: World Bank. Measured in % of property value.
Analysis
In 2019, registering property: cost in Kosovo stood at 0.3%.
The figure is down 50.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, registering property: cost in Kosovo peaked at 0.6% in 2009 and was at its lowest, 0.2%, in 2013.
Kosovo ranks 170th of 187 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 11 years of available data.

About this data
The cost is the total of official costs associated with completing the procedures to transfer the property, expressed as a percentage of the property value, assumed to be equivalent to 50 times income per capita. It is calculted as a percentage of the property value. Only official costs required by law are recorded, including fees, transfer taxes, stamp duties and any other payment to the property registry, notaries, public agencies or lawyers. Other taxes, such as capital gains tax or value added tax, are excluded from the cost measure. Both costs borne by the buyer and the seller are included. If cost estimates differ among sources, the median reported value is used.
